+namespace ConfigMem {
|
|
|
+
|
|
|
+enum {
|
|
|
+ KERNEL_VERSIONREVISION = 0x1FF80001,
|
|
|
+ KERNEL_VERSIONMINOR = 0x1FF80002,
|
|
|
+ KERNEL_VERSIONMAJOR = 0x1FF80003,
|
|
|
+ UPDATEFLAG = 0x1FF80004,
|
|
|
+ NSTID = 0x1FF80008,
|
|
|
+ SYSCOREVER = 0x1FF80010,
|
|
|
+ UNITINFO = 0x1FF80014,
|
|
|
+ KERNEL_CTRSDKVERSION = 0x1FF80018,
|
|
|
+ APPMEMTYPE = 0x1FF80030,
|
|
|
+ APPMEMALLOC = 0x1FF80040,
|
|
|
+ FIRM_VERSIONREVISION = 0x1FF80061,
|
|
|
+ FIRM_VERSIONMINOR = 0x1FF80062,
|
|
|
+ FIRM_VERSIONMAJOR = 0x1FF80063,
|
|
|
+ FIRM_SYSCOREVER = 0x1FF80064,
|
|
|
+ FIRM_CTRSDKVERSION = 0x1FF80068,
|
|
|
+};
|
|
|
+
|
|
|
+template <typename T>
|
|
|
+inline void Read(T &var, const u32 addr) {
|
|
|
+ switch (addr) {
|
|
|
+
|
|
|
+ // Bit 0 set for Retail
|
|
|
+ case UNITINFO:
|
|
|
+ var = 0x00000001;
|
|
|
+ break;
|
|
|
+
|
|
|
+ // Set app memory size to 64MB?
|
|
|
+ case APPMEMALLOC:
|
|
|
+ var = 0x04000000;
|
|
|
+ break;
|
|
|
+
|
|
|
+ // Unknown - normally set to: 0x08000000 - (APPMEMALLOC + *0x1FF80048)
|
|
|
+ // (Total FCRAM size - APPMEMALLOC - *0x1FF80048)
|
|
|
+ case 0x1FF80044:
|
|
|
+ var = 0x08000000 - (0x04000000 + 0x1400000);
|
|
|
+ break;
|
|
|
+
|
|
|
+ // Unknown - normally set to: 0x1400000 (20MB)
|
|
|
+ case 0x1FF80048:
|
|
|
+ var = 0x1400000;
|
|
|
+ break;
|
|
|
+
|
|
|
+ default:
|
|
|
+ ERROR_LOG(HLE, "unknown ConfigMem::Read%d @ 0x%08X", sizeof(var) * 8, addr);
|
|
|
+ }
|
|
|
+}
